The Hampton Sheriff’s Office is seeking an experienced and strategic Director of Administration to lead critical business and operational support functions for the agency. This senior leadership role oversees human resources, payroll, finance, budgeting, procurement, commissary, warehouse operations, and administrative services to ensure the office runs efficiently and in full compliance with applicable laws, regulations, and agency standards.
Reporting directly to the Undersheriff or the Sheriff’s designee, this position serves as a trusted advisor on administrative, financial, and operational matters. The Director of Administration plays a key role in supporting executive leadership, improving internal processes, managing staff, and ensuring accountability across essential support functions. This is an at-will, exempt position that serves at the pleasure of the Sheriff.
Key Responsibilities:- Lead and oversee HR, finance, payroll, procurement, and administrative functions
- Develop and manage the agency’s operating budget and financial reporting
- Ensure compliance with local, state, and federal regulations and procurement laws
- Serve as a key advisor to executive leadership on administrative and fiscal matters
- Supervise staff, assign priorities, and support professional development
- Manage contracts, vendor relationships, and purchasing processes
- Oversee audits, financial reconciliations, and inmate fund operations
- Improve processes, enhance efficiency, and support organizational goals
Minimum Qualifications:- Graduation from an accredited college or university with major course work in accounting, finance, business administration, public administration, or a related field
- A minimum of five (5) years of progressively responsible experience in public-sector finance, procurement, contract administration, or administrative management is required.
- Candidates must demonstrate: ·
- At least three (3) years of experience supervising a high-volume purchasing, finance, or administrative office.
- Experience in contract development, negotiation, and administration.
- Knowledge of and experience with procurement processes in compliance with applicable federal, state, and local regulations.
- Supervisory experience overseeing professional and administrative staff.
- An equivalent combination of education and experience may be considered.
- Must successfully pass a background investigation before employment.
- May be required to meet Department of Criminal Justice Services standards for firearms qualification.
- Must possess and maintain a valid driver’s license with a satisfactory driving record.
Additional Requirements: - The incumbent may be considered “essential personnel” during city emergencies, or at the direction of the City Manager or designee, which may include long hours and unusual schedules.
